<br />PRDGR"-'l REVIE'w' <br /> <br />by <br />Olin Foehner <br />Bureau of Reclawation <br /> <br />At this tillle I \...i.ll e:A1Jlain some of the backgrOl.md leading up to <br />this conference. ~fumy of you are quite fa~iliar with the ~urk that <br />has been done on the Sierra Cooperative .Pilot Project. Q.1ite a few <br />of you have been involved in the preliminary work. <br /> <br />There \-.ill be quite a bit more disOlssion as we go along on defining <br />things in nore detail. But generally the purpose of the sepp is to <br />develop an acceptable technology for increasing the water supply from <br />the Sierra Nevada. Ke have been looking at areas that are best suited <br />for this progra.'"!l since its beginning several years ago. <br /> <br />WIth the cooperation of the California Department of Water Resources <br />we began by looking into both the Feather River Basin and the .~erican <br />Ri\~er Basin as potential areas for study. Through the efforts of the <br />prelTIninary design and the interest ~nich has grown in the project area, <br />the selection \...ClS made to concentrate on the i\mericaTl. River Basin. <br /> <br />l\"e have recently received a request frafi t.~e State of !\evada to consider <br />enlarging the project area to include t.he Tahoe-Truckee area as well. <br />The plans \....e Kill be talking about at this conference take into considera- <br />tion that extension. A formal arrangement wi. th Nevada hasn't been reached, <br />but we eJl..-pect this will be done \-;hen both parties can define the area and <br />Khen Xevada cOrlpletes its emergency drought-relief program.
